JDK安装与配置

  JDK的全称是JavaSE Development Kit,即java开发工具包,是sun公司提供的一套用于开发java应用程序的开发包,它提供了编译、运行java程序所需的各种工具和资源,包括java编译器、java运行时环境,以及常用的java类库等。

这是又设计到一个概念:JRE,全称Java Runtime Environment ,java运行时环境。它是运行java程序的必须条件。

一般而言,如果只是运行java程序,可以只安装JRE,无需安装JDK。

1. JDK的下载

第一步:登录http://www.oracle.com/cn/index.html,点击导航栏上“菜单”,选择“下载”目录下的“开发人员下载”,我们可以看到图1-1所示的页面。

图1-1 开发人员下载

第二步:点击图1-1中“开发人员下载”,进入该页面后,找到JAVA专栏,点击图1-2 中的“Java SE(包括 javaFx)|预览版”

图1-2 开发人员下载页面

第三步:点击图1-2 中的“Java SE(包括 javaFx)|预览版”进入JDK下载页面

图1-3 JDK的下载页面

第四步:在JDK的下载页面中首先看到的是目前JDK最新版本JDK8,在本课程中我们统一安装JDK1.7.51。此时只需在如1-3所示的页面中向下看,在页面的最后有“Java存档”,点击“java存档”右侧的“DOWNLOAD”按钮即可进入JDK的历史版本页面见图1-5。

图1-4 Java存档

图1-5 JDK历史版本页面

第五步:在JDK历史版本页面中,找到JDK7,点击“Java SE7”,进入JDK7的历史更新包位置。

图1-6 JDK7历史更新包页面

第六步:在JDK7历是更新包页面中找到你想要的版本,我自己用的是JDK7.51,在下载页面,点击“Accent Lincense Agreement”接受协议,

图1-7 JDK7.51下载页面

第六步:接受协议之后,既可以根据自己的系统的版本下载对应的JDK图1-7示。下载完成之后可以看到图1-8所示的一个压缩包。

图1-8 下载相应版本的JDK

图1-9 下载完成

到此JDK的下载工作已经完成。


2. JDK的安装

第一步:解压下载好的JDK7.51,如图2-1示。

图2-1 解压下载好的JDK

第二步:双击打开安装文件,注意安装与操作系统对应版本;在此我安装的是64的JDK。

图2-1 JDK安装向导

第三步:选择图2-1页面中的“下一步”,进入安装路径选择页面。选择安装路径时,注意:不要选择带中文及特殊符号的路径,也尽量不要安装到C盘。

图2-2 JDK安装路径选择

图2-3 JDK安装中

第四步:在第三步基础上选择“下一步”,选择是否安装JRE,这里我们选择安装(当然也可以不安装,开发中我们只装jdk就行)。选择好JRE的安装路径后点击“下一步”,图2-5为JRE安装完成后的界面,点击“关闭”,JRE安装成功。

图2-4 JRE安装路径选择页面

图2-5 JRE安装完成页面

第五步:JDK和JRE安装成功之后的目录结构如下图示。

图2-6 JDK安装成功后目录

图2-7 JRE安装成功后目录

第六步:验证jdk是否安装安装成功。

(1)win+r运行cmd,打开dos窗口

(2)进入jdk安装目录下的bin目录

(3)输入javac屏幕输出帮助信息即安装成功

图2-9 JDK安装成功测试

3、环境变量的配置

在Java开发时,会经常用Java命令时,可是在DOS命令中,这些不属于windows自己的命令,所以要想使用,就需要进行路径配置。 

步骤如下:

3.1 win7系统下:单击“计算机-属性-高级系统设置”,单击“环境变量”。在“系统变量”栏下单击“新建”,创建新的系统环境变量。

图3-1 环境变量

3.2、新建变量值

(1)新建->变量名"JAVA_HOME",变量值"C:\Java\jdk1.8.0_05"(即JDK的安装路径)

图3-2新建变量

图3-3新建变量

如果安装多个jdk版本,可添加多个JAVA变量来区分

变量名   JAVA_HOME  变量值:(开发需要的环境变量)%JAVA7_HOME%

变量名  JAVA7_HOME   变量值:对应jdk7的地址

变量名  JAVA8_HOME   变量值:对应jdk8的地址

(3)新建->变量名“CLASSPATH”,变量值“.;%JAVA_HOME%\lib;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ar”  根据图3-2和图3-3新建

(2)编辑->变量名"Path",在原变量值的最后面加上“;%JAVA_HOME%\bin;%JAVA_HOME%\jre\bin”

注:这个path变量值要添加在最前面

3.3 验证环境变量配置是否正确

(1)win+r运行cmd,打开dos窗口

(2)输入命令java/javac/java -version这三个其中一个都可以验证

图3-4 java命令

图3-5 javac命令

图3-6 java -version命令

注:若在CMD中输入javac test.java命令后,显示‘javac‘不是内部或外部命令,原因是因为没有提前安装好JDK开发环境或环境变量配置有误。

4、Java程序的编译和运行

用txt记事本编写一段java程序:helloword.java

1 public class helloword {
2     public static void main(String[]  args){
3           System.out.println("Hello 女汉纸~");
4     }
5  }

把helloword.java程序文件放到C盘根目录下,在cmd中输入javac helloword.java编译程序后,输入java  helloword,运行该程序,显示“Hello 女汉纸~“

图4-1 编译执行helloword

图4-2 helloword流程执行原理

时间: 2024-10-13 11:55:33

JDK安装与配置的相关文章

CentOS下JDK安装和配置

JDK安装和配置 第一步:安装JDK 1.下载jdk-1.8.0,rz到指定目录下 2.tar开 $>su centos ;cd ~ $>mkdir downloads $>cp jdk-1.8.0 ~\downloads $>tar -xzvf jdk-1.8.0 3.创建/soft文件夹,并移动tar开的文件到soft下 $>sudo mkdir /soft $>sudo chown centos:centos /soft    //更改目录的所属用户 $>m

jdk安装和配置环境变量

jdk安装和配置环境变量 一.jdk安装 1.下载jdk安装包(jdk1.8/Windows 64位) 链接:https://pan.baidu.com/s/1gqeQcPzbiHDAan9NekI3PA 提取码:bm25 2.点击安装jdk(一路下一步) 3.安装jre 4.等待安装完成关闭即可. 二.jdk配置环境变量 此电脑右击-->属性-->高级系统管理-->点击环境变量 在系统变量处,新建一个系统变量 变量名:JAVA_HOME 变量值:D:\Program Files\Jav

PyCharm和JDK安装与配置(windows)

一.PyCharm安装与配置 PyCharm 是一款功能强大的 Python 编辑器,具有跨平台性,鉴于目前最新版 PyCharm 使用教程较少,为了节约时间,来介绍一下 PyCharm 在 Windows下是如何安装的. 这是 PyCharm 的下载地址:http://www.jetbrains.com/pycharm/download/#section=windows 进入该网站后,我们会看到如下界面: professional 表示专业版,community 是社区版,推荐安装社区版,因为

【Linux】 JDK安装及配置 (tar.gz版)

安装环境 Linux(Ubuntu 版) JDK安装 tar.gz为解压后就可以使用的版本,这里我将使用jdk-8u65-linux-x64.tar.gz版,安装到/usr/java/下 步骤一 将文件jdk-8u65-linux-x64.gz移动到/usr/java/下,并解压: tar -xzvf  jdk-8u65-linux-x64.gz 步骤二 在/etc/profile文件中,配置环境变量,是JDK在所有用户中生效: 打开/etc/profile文件 vi /etc/profile

Window下JDK安装与配置

今天项目组开会,由于.Net平台的限制无法满足现有业务需求,项目计划从.Net平台转Java平台,采用Java+Spark+Hadoop,之前关于Java和Hadoop的书也买的有只是平时看的少,最近也都是在看关于股票和项目架构的书,放在那好久了,正好凑着项目转Java的机会把Java也学一下,Hadoop的话先放一放,其实都是面向对象的编程语言,主要还是编程思想,和C#都是差不多,所以要转Java我还真不怕,之前也不是没转过,当时自学半个月oc就直接从C#转iOS了,一个字就是干!撸起袖子就是

Linux JDK安装及配置 (tar.gz版)

安装环境 Linux(Ubuntu 版) JDK安装 tar.gz为解压后就可以使用的版本,这里我将使用jdk-8u65-linux-x64.tar.gz版,安装到/usr/java/下 步骤一 将文件移动到jdk-8u65-linux-x64.tar.gz移动到/usr/java/下,并解压: tar -xzvf  jdk-8u65-linux-x64.rpm 步骤二 在/etc/profile文件中,配置环境变量,是JDK在所有用户中生效: 打开/etc/profile文件 vi /etc/

JDK安装和配置

步骤 1     使用sftp工具上传JDK安装包jdk-7u7-linux-x64.rpm. 步骤 2     切换至root用户,安装jdk_1.7.0_07 # su – root # rpm –ivh jdk-7u7-linux-x64.rpm 步骤 3     配置环境变量,修改/etc/profile文件,根据jdk安装的路径把环境变量添加至末尾 # vi /etc/profile 添加内容 JAVA_HOME=/usr/java/jdk1.7.0_07 JRE_HOME=/usr/

Ubuntu 14.04 jdk安装与配置

(1)jdk安装 需要在ubuntu下使用Pycharm,但是Pycharm是用Java写的,所以必须安装jdk.安装的方法很多,上官网找了适合Ubuntu的,给出下面的文档: ============================================ Installation of the 64-bit JDK on Linux Platforms This procedure installs the Java Development Kit (JDK) for 64-bit

Java基础之JDK安装与配置

配置环境变量名词说明 ??? path:通过path系统去寻找可执行的java文件. ??? JAVA_HOME:JDK的安装目录 ??? classpath:加载目录 为什么需要配置path,什么时候需要classpath? ??? path: ??????? 系统变量path告诉系统可执行文件所在的路径,当发现某个可执行文件时,默认先从当前目录寻找,如果没有找到 ??? 就会到path所设定路径的路径去寻找,然后执行. ????? ? ??? classpath: ??????? 是告诉JV